In France, we're currently in the middle of a finance bill. It's now clear and decided that Banks/Insurers in France will be able to offer investments tied to cryptocurrencies funds. The new framework is ready and waiting for publication.
It won't target individuals (only if you have a $500k portfolio) but professional investors. Better than nothing, at least cryptos hit the banks here, in 2 years everyone will get access to it, who knows? Private equity investment funds (FPCIs) are also concerned
This was not the primary objective of the Pact, but insurers will be able to offer products based on crypto-assets. They will be able to do so through specialized funds", confirms the LREM deputy and budget rapporteur, Joel Giraud. The new framework will be operational after the publication of the implementing decrees
